Cross-Margining Risk
Meaning ⎊ The danger that a loss in one leveraged position forces the liquidation of other unrelated positions using shared collateral.
Negative Balance Protection
Meaning ⎊ A structural safeguard preventing a trader's account from falling into a debt state beyond their initial collateral.
Liquidity Liquidation Cascades
Meaning ⎊ Forced closing of leveraged positions causing a chain reaction of trades that accelerates price moves and market volatility.

Auto-Deleveraging Engines
Meaning ⎊ A last-resort system that closes profitable positions to cover losses when exchange insurance funds are depleted.
